Vegetation fire burns near Marinole Road by railroad, Nevada County CA


A vegetation fire about 20 by 20 feet is burning in grass near Marinole Road, close to the Union Pacific Railroad. The fire is about 40 feet from nearby structures. The cause of the fire is unknown, and multiple fire units are responding.
